Michel Pierre St. Pierre dit Dessaint 1610–1650 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 10 June 1610

Birth Location: Rouen, Seine-Maritime, Haute-Normandie, France

Death Date: 1650

Death Location: St-Martin du Pont, Rouen, Normandie, France

Father: Guillaume Dessaint

Mother: Marie Quéval-Philippes

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1610, Michel Pierre St. Pierre dit Dessaint entered the world in Rouen, Seine-Maritime, Haute-Normandie, France, born to Guillaume St Pierre Dit Dessaint And Marie Queval Philippes. Michel Pierre St. Pierre dit Dessaint passed away in 1650 in St-Martin du Pont, Rouen, Normandie, France.
